Abstract
There exists a significant body of literature, developed over the last 10 years or so, concerned with the theoretical analysis of atmospherically induced wavefront aberrations in terms of Zernike polynomial decompositions and power spectra of the Zernike modes (1-4). To date there has not been a satisfactory experimental verification of these analyses.
